Builds on Windows are reproducible as long as core.autocrlf=false and core.eol=lf are set before cloning the repo. Otherwise, Syncthing's GUI assets will have CRLF line endings. The gradle scripts now also have to strip out the .comment ELF section since the same version of the NDK writes different comment strings on different host platforms.
